Check with your electricity supplier first

I bought the critterguard and it is a good piece of equipment. The PROBLEM is the local membership electricity would not allow me to install it on the line to the house. So what good is it?

That's a shame. BUT -- don't give up yet. Because if you do you that still won't solve your problem.

So here's what we recommend: Call them back and ask to speak to someone in DISTRIBUTION (that's the group that takes care of residential overhead lines). If the Cust. Service rep asks why, tell them you have technical questions about the overhead lines. Ideally you want to speak to someone in operations or maintenance. Tell them what you're trying to do and give them the website of Critter Guard and the EVIDENCE of other utilities throughout the US and globally using the product (going on 20 years now). We have lots of photos and install videos online you can point them to. If they still tell you no, you could try other contractor types - such as tree trimmers or DIY handymen. It's not hard or unsafe to install, but you want someone who can get up there and get access to the line without falling or pulling it down. Anybody with a 'bucket truck' (lift truck) is ideal, and we have thousands of customers who found a way.

If you get a 'real person' at the utility who seems 'on the fence', we're happy to speak with them on your behalf.

Good luck!

I am pleased to report that my latest installation has thus far been successful in thwarting one ...

I am pleased to report that my latest installation has thus far been successful in thwarting one astonishingly savvy squirrel who managed to figure out how to traverse a previous flashing-based abatement installation method that had been effective for 15-20 years prior.

My wife and I donned climbing harnesses and she belayed me up to a tree limb high enough for me to install multiple rollers and wheels on the line between a phone pole in our yard and the drop atop our roof.

In the following days, my wife and I made a point of posting up outside through sundown, just to witness said rodent try to navigate our latest installation. In the first days, we watched him cautiously tread atop said loosely wrapped metal flashing until he encountered the first wheel. We watched him then test the wheel with one paw while struggling to remain balanced with the other three, precariously perched atop an unstable surface roughly 35 feet above deck -- and a stone one at that. Once the squirrel ascertained that the wheel spun freely about the line and he couldn't get a read on the stability of the rollers behind it, we watched with no small measure of glee as he retreated back to the pole. This moment was especially significant in that he had previously managed to grow comfortable enough with the "flashing traverse" to build a nest, which is the "flash point" for yours truly.

My wife and I observed this behavior on two successive evenings. Then, to our utter delight, we haven't seen him again test that particular route, nor have we since seen him in the canopy of our two beloved, mature live oaks.

And so, John, we thank you for your product and we thank you again for flowing us the spare roller, which I left uncut in order to buttress the entire string assembly along a power line running on a ~30-degree pitch (which, as you may know, is harder to protect than a level line).

Dear AG, Thanks for this detail about the squirrel's behavior when they encounter the Line Guard. Our whole philosophy in the product was to create a 'barrier', not just a cover. The squirrel (and most other crawling critters) use the overhead line as a highway to get where they want to go. The Line Guard system BLOCKS this highway. Glad you got to see visual proof!
